Bridge from Positional to Tactical Lessons


Level

Intermediate, Advanced


Recommended Rating

900 -1700


Topic Purpose

We’ve learned about position and hypermodern chess elements. And we’ve learned about basic and intermediate tactics. This series teaches different techniques to bridge from a positional advantage to a tactical advantage.

Lessons: (each lesson is about 1 hour)

     Lesson 1 learning objectives

  • Teaches how to use the octopus.
  • Teaches how to use the killer knight.

    Lesson 2 learning objectives

  • Teaches how to use the dominating center-back knight.
  • Teaches the knight attack from the edge.

     Lesson 3 learning objectives

  • Teaches attacking with the g5 knight.
  • Teaches attacking with the h5 knight.

     Lesson 4 learning objectives

  • Teaches how to use the trapped bishop.
  • Teaches how to use the twin gun bishops.

     Lesson 5 learning objectives

  • Teaches how to use the beast.
  • Teaches how to use a doubled f-pawn.

     Lesson 6 learning objectives

  • Teaches when to capture towards the edge.
  • Teaches how to use doubled a-pawns (or h-pawns) in an attack.

     Lesson 7 learning objectives

  • Teaches when to block with your queen.
  • Teaches the pawn bypass.

     Lesson 8 learning objectives

  • Teaches a common sacrifice with a pawn on c5.
  • Teaches when to sacrifice a pawn on e6

     Lesson 9 learning objectives

  • Teaches the rook sacrifice on e6 for a bishop.
  • Teaches the rook sacrifice on c6 and f6 for a knight.

     Lesson 10 learning objectives

  • Teaches how to create the avalanche.
  • Teaches how to use the fish hook.

      Lesson 11 earning objectives

  • Teaches how to use the colossus.
  • Teaches how to demolish the castle.

     Lesson 12 learning objectives

  • Teaches how to use the Nievergelt Maneuver.
  • Teaches how to use the Bishop-in-the-way.

     Lesson 13 learning objectives

  • Teaches when to trade queens and when to avoid it.
  • Teaches how to use the runner and the bulldozer.
